Programs & Activities
Program 1
$270KPatient education: our patient education initiatives expand across online materials such as our website, podcasts, social media and on printed materials. Natf publishes a bi-monthly newsletter, the beat, where patients can learn about groundbreaking research in the thrombosis field and get a first-hand look at natf's upcoming events and initiatives. Our website, thrombosis.org, is our biggest educational tool for patients. In 2023, we've expanded on our related conditions categories for patients to include peripheral arterial disease (pad), cancer and thrombosis, and transgender health and blood clot risk. We run ads to promote our patient materials such as the beat, online articles, our patient support groups, and related conditions we've focused on.
Program 2
$100KBwh research and fellowship: the north american thrombosis forum made a charitable donation of $100,000 to brigham and women's hospital to support research and fellowship in honor of dr. Samuel z. Goldhaber. This donation establishes the samuel z. Goldhaber, md, fellow support fund, a permanently restricted endowment within the department of medicine. The annual distributions from this fund will support the education and training of a vascular medicine fellow or a cardiovascular medicine fellow, thereby advancing the natf's educational mission.
Program 3
$554KCme programs $317 thousand: part of natf's mission is to educate healthcare professionals through our innovative programming. This category includes the continuing medical education programs we offered throughout the year. Our programs brought together over 30 world-renowned faculty to educate an audience of clinical and research professionals who study and/or care for patients with right heart disease, congenital heart disease, pulmonary hypertension, cardiometabolic disease, and associated disorders relating to thrombosis.
Program 4
$72KCholesterol conversations: natf launched cholesterol conversations, a limited-series podcast for healthcare professionals discussing the latest guidance on ascvd management and available treatment options for optimal ldl-c lowering. New data on the efficacy of novel agents and combination therapy was also highlighted.
